Healthy Chicken Marinades for Weight Loss Meal Prep (5 Flavors)

Five flavorful chicken marinades built on real flavors: citrus, garlic, herbs, and smart seasoning with no added sugars. Each marinade layers acid, aromatics, and herbs to create juicy, delicious chicken perfect for meal prep without tasting like you're dieting.

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• zip-top bag or shallow container
  • grill or sheet pan or skillet

Ingredients
  

  • For Lemon Herb Garlic: 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ice, 3 tablespoons olive oil, 5 cloves garlic minced, 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ard, 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, 1 tablespoon fresh thyme,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• For Lime Cilantro: 1/4 cup fresh lime juice, 3 tablespoons avocado oil, 4 cloves garlic minced, 1 small jalapeño minced, 1/3 cup fresh cilantro chopped, 1/2 teaspoon cumin, 1/4 teaspoon salt, pinch cayenne
  • For Soy Ginger Sesame: 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ce, 2 tablespoons rice vinegar, 2 tablespoons sesame oil, 3 cloves garlic minced, 1 tablespoon fresh ginger minced, 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• For Balsamic Fig: 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ar, 3 tablespoons olive oil, 3 cloves garlic minced, 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ard, 1 tablespoon fig jam, 1 teaspoon fresh thyme,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• For Greek Oregano Lemon: 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ice, 1 tablespoon red wine vinegar, 3 tablespoons olive oil, 4 cloves garlic minced, 2 tablespoons fresh oregano,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per, pinch red pepper flakes
  • Base protein: 4-5 boneless skinless chicken breasts (6 ounces each)

Instructions
 

  • Step 1: Combine your chosen marinade ingredients in a bowl. Whisk together the acid, oil, and mustard first to create an emulsion.
  • Step 2: Add your aromatics and seasonings. Stir in minced garlic, fresh herbs, and spices. Taste the marinade - it should taste bold and flavorful.
  • Step 3: Place chicken breasts in a gallon-size zip-top bag or shallow container.
  • Step 4: Pour the marinade over the chicken, ensuring every piece is coated. Seal the bag and remove as much air as possible.
  • Step 5: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ight. The longer the marinade sits, the more flavor penetrates the meat. Do not marinate longer than 24 hours.
  • Step 6: Remove from refrigerator 20 minutes before cooking for even cooking.
  • Step 7: Cook using your preferred method: grilling, sheet pan baking, or pan-searing until internal temperature reaches 165°F (about 20-30 minutes depending on method).

Notes

Store marinated chicken in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ours before cooking. After cooking, refrigerate prepared meals for up to 4 days or freeze for up to 3 months. Each chicken breast provides approximately 35 grams of complete protein with 165 calories. These marinades work with grilling, baking, or pan-searing. Pairs well with brown rice, roasted vegetables, or fresh salads. The marinade base formula of acid, oil, aromatics, and seasonings can be adapted based on available ingredients.
